noi*_*isy 6 git merge conflict
有一个很好的选择--patch,可以使用git add.
使用此选项,我可以轻松查看我的所有更改,并决定应将哪些块添加到临时区域.可以通过所有修改的文件进行此交互式过程.
我正在寻找类似的解决冲突的东西.之后rebase或者merge您经常会获得both modified文件列表.
有没有命令:
1)会帮助我遍历所有这些both modified文件吗?当我必须将每个路径复制到文件以手动打开它时,这非常烦人.
2)将自动解决所有冲突始终使用HEAD /主版本?
经过多年的寻找,我终于找到了解决我的问题的方法!它并不完美,当然这并不能解决我所有的问题,但这绝对加快了我的工作速度!
它称为git imerge(增量合并)。
乍一看,这有点令人难以接受,而且看起来很复杂,但增量合并背后的想法非常简单。
当然,您应该看看GitMerge 2013 会议(20 分钟)中的 git-imerge 演示。
如果您喜欢阅读文本,请参阅git-imerge:实用介绍